32-40 Ballard is the meat and potatoes schuetzen caliber here in America...
Ah! You didn't say "32-40 Ballard" in your post. Here in my cowboy America we have a late-1800's cartridge called the 32-40 Winchester, with many lever action rifles chambered for it. Quite different cartridge from the 32-40 Ballard.
